Output d09678c2093e32c6fc95f381e7f482806ce118795cf346caa7014ea395e0908c:9

value
499278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1f523c47702c6f37a5920ed17b1e9ed4b66d566 OP_EQUAL
address
3PkNSP3v5joHz5PXRnpWRfxyr1psfudedB
transaction
d09678c2093e32c6fc95f381e7f482806ce118795cf346caa7014ea395e0908c
confirmations
251971
spent
true